Abstract

An apparatus for manufacturing a heat exchanger for a vehicle has a plurality of cooling panels bonded to each other by pressing a cooling panel module where the plurality of cooling panels are stacked vertically, including: a fixing portion for supporting top and bottom ends of the cooling panel module; and a pair of elastic portions that are provided between the top or bottom end of the cooling panel module and the fixing portion, and are arranged symmetrically based on a top or bottom surface of the cooling panel module to compress the cooling panel module.

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. An apparatus for manufacturing a heat exchanger for a vehicle in which a plurality of cooling panels are bonded to each other by pressing a cooling panel module where the plurality of cooling panels are stacked vertically, comprising:
 a fixing portion for supporting top and bottom ends of the cooling panel module; and   at least one pair of elastic portions that are provided between the top or bottom end of the cooling panel module and the fixing portion, and arranged symmetrically based on a top or bottom surface of the cooling panel module to compress the cooling panel module.   
     
     
         2 . The apparatus of  claim 1 , further comprising a diffusion panel provided between the elastic portion and the top or bottom surface of the cooling panel module so as to diffuse load of the elastic portion. 
     
     
         3 . The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the cooling panel is provided with an inlet through which coolant is input and an outlet through which the coolant is discharged, and further comprising a support pin for supporting at least one of the inlet and the outlet so as to prevent deformation of the inlet and the outlet when the cooling panel module is compressed. 
     
     
         4 . The apparatus of  claim 3 , wherein the support pins are provided on the inlet and the outlet, respectively. 
     
     
         5 . The apparatus of  claim 3 , wherein the support pins have a honeycomb structure. 
     
     
         6 . An apparatus for manufacturing a heat exchanger for a vehicle, comprising:
 a plurality of cooling panels bonded to each other by pressing a cooling panel module, wherein the plurality of cooling panels are stacked vertically;   a fixing portion for supporting top and bottom ends of the cooling panel module; and   a pair of elastic portions provided between the top or bottom end of the cooling panel module and the fixing portion, and arranged symmetrically based on a top or bottom surface of the cooling panel module to compress the cooling panel module.   
     
     
         7 . A method for manufacturing a heat exchanger for a vehicle, comprising:
 providing a plurality of cooling panels bonded to each other by pressing a cooling panel module where the plurality of cooling panels are stacked vertically, wherein each cooling panel is provided with an inlet through which coolant is input and an outlet through which the coolant is discharged;   inserting a support pin into at least one of the inlet and the outlet of the cooling panel;   brazing the cooling panel module where the support pin inserted into at least one of the inlet and the outlet of the cooling panel; and   cutting the end of at least one of the inlet and the outlet of the cooling panel.   
     
     
         8 . The method for manufacturing a heat exchanger for a vehicle of  claim 7 , wherein the part to be cut at the cutting step includes the scrap that is formed at the brazing step. 
     
     
         9 . The method for manufacturing a heat exchanger for a vehicle of  claim 7 , wherein the brazing that is performed at the brazing step is a vacuum-brazing.
